zila Yojna Samiti Adhiniyam,1995State Act of Madhya Pradesh · Act 19 of 1995

(1) "There shall be constituted for a revenue district or a group of revenue districts and part thereof with a common Zila Panchayat a District Planning Committee, to consolidate the plans prepared by the Panchayats and Municipalities in the district and to prepare a draft development plan for the district as a whole."

(2) Every Committee shall, preparing the draft development plan: -

(a) have regard to -

(i) Matters of common interest between the Panchayats and Municipalities including spatial planning, sharing of water and other physical and natural resources, the integrated development of infrastructure and environmental conservation;

(ii) The extent and type of available resources whether financial or otherwise;

(b) Consult such institutions and organisations as the State Government may, by order, specify.

(3) Where the term of the existing members of the Municipality /Zila Panchayat has expired and the elected members cease to be members of the committee then the committee with remaining members shall continue to discharge the functions till new elections are held.
